Dinner benefits MVCAP Oct. 29

Tickets are on sale now for the seventh Progressive Dinner in downtown Warren to benefit the Mahoning Valley College Access Program.

The Oct. 29 event starts with cocktails and bites at BRITE Energy Innovators, followed by appetizers from Cockeye BBQ served at Trumbull Art Gallery and a soup and salad course at Beautiful Whirl’d. Participants then can have their dinner entree at Charbenay’s Wine on the River, Jacked Steakhouse, Saratoga Restaurant or West & Main Grill before the event concludes with desserts & coffee from Mocha House served at BRITE Energy Innovators.

The cost is $75 per person, $150 per couple or $550 per table. Tickets can be purchased by emailing Gerri Jerkins at director@themvcap.org.
